In this review of the WHITIN Women's Wide Zero Drop Training Shoes we look at who will get the most from them and the single biggest reason to buy: they provide a roomy, comfortable fit combined with a flat, zero drop sole that encourages a more natural foot strike. These shoes are presented as a fashionable, day-to-day sneaker with a wide toe box and cushioned midsole, and the review focuses on real-world wearability for everyday use and light training rather than as specialized performance running footwear.

Key Features

  • Wide toe box: Provides ample room for toes to spread and reduces pinching for people with wider feet or bunions.
  • Zero drop design: Promotes a more natural gait by keeping heel and forefoot level, which can help distribute impact more evenly.
  • Cushioned midsole: Delivers noticeable shock absorption for daily walking and light training, helping reduce stress on the feet.
  • Durable rubber outsole: Offers improved traction and a longer service life on urban surfaces and light trails.
  • Classic styling: A fashionable, versatile look that works for casual outfits and everyday activities.

Who It's For

These shoes are best for women who want a stylish everyday sneaker with extra toe room and a natural-feel sole. They suit people with wider feet, bunions, or anyone who prefers a non-elevated, zero drop platform for walking, commuting, or casual training.

They are less suited to runners seeking maximal heel cushioning, high-performance stability features, or highly structured arch support. If you need heavy-duty running shoes for long-distance training or aggressive trail conditions, a more specialized model would be a better fit.

Our Verdict

The WHITIN Women's Wide Zero Drop Training Shoes are a solid everyday option for women who prioritize toe-room, a natural zero drop platform, and reliable cushioning for daily use. They offer good value for casual wear and light training, especially for wider feet, but those needing strong arch support or advanced running cushioning should consider more specialized options.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are these shoes good for bunions?
Yes, the roomy wide toe box and gentle fit make them a comfortable choice for many people with bunions.

Do they provide strong arch support?
Arch support feedback is mixed; some users find it adequate for everyday wear while others prefer added support from orthotics.

Can I use these for running?
They are suitable for light running and training, but not designed as high-performance running shoes for long distances.
